Always great to see these and the cobalt blue face really makes the pen pop. I've got to wonder though with Rolex parts being so expensive are these taken from the knock off watches...? I would hate to think that a real Rolex was fixed...well, you know.


Tim, I use known Rolex dealers and buy authentic dials that have have been replaced for any number of reasons. The better condition of the dial reflects with the cost of the blank. The dials are real Rolex, but as Roy stated, they are the only Rolex part in the blank.
